soak in French

soak in French is tremper, faire tremper, immerger — soak means to leave something in liquid until it becomes thoroughly wet.

soak in French

tremper
verb
(intransitive) To be saturated with liquid by being immersed in it.
faire tremper
verb
(transitive) To immerse in liquid to the point of saturation or thorough permeation.
immerger
verb
(transitive) To immerse in liquid to the point of saturation or thorough permeation.
éponger
verb
(transitive) To allow (especially a liquid) to be absorbed; to take in, receive. (usually + up)

What does "soak" mean?

  1. verb To leave something in liquid until it becomes thoroughly wet.
    "Soak the beans overnight before cooking them."
  2. verb Informal: to charge someone an excessive amount of money.
    "The garage really soaked us for that repair."
  3. noun A period of being immersed in liquid.
    "She treated herself to a long soak in the bathtub."
